1 PAIN/ MEDICATIONS. Gum surgery, like other operations, could be accompanied by varying amounts of pain. In order to best take care of any discomfort, the following is advised: Continue taking all prescription drugs unless or else guided For the initial 36 hrs after surgical procedure, take 600mg of Ibuprophen (Advil) every 6 humans resources. This will minimize swelling, which lessens pain. If an 800mg dosage is used, take every 8 hours. Take Ibuprophen along with food to stay clear of indigestion. Do not take Ibuprophen if your medical professional has actually encouraged you to not take Ibuprophen or NSAIDS (non-steroidal anti-inflammatories). Relying on the procedure carried out, you may have been given a prescription for a pain drug. To guarantee appropriate healing, take exactly as routed. If you were recommended anti-biotics for your treatment, it is essential to take as guided, and till gone. Not abiding with antibiotic instructions could significantly impact the results of your executed procedure. 2 BLEEDING. Minor bleeding or "oozing" from the surgical website is anticipated for the first 2 days If sudden profuse bleeding happens, contact your physician right away or seek instant treatment via Emergency Room. 3 SWELLING AND BRUSING. Minor swelling after periodontal procedures prevails. Depending on the procedure performed, swelling may remain to increase for approximately 36 humans resources. Call your doctor if swelling proceeds to enhance after 36 hrs and also is come with by extreme discomfort. This might signify infection. Any huge or unusual swelling must be reported to your physician quickly. If swelling intrudes upon airway, look for prompt treatment by means of Emergency clinic. To minimize swelling, use ice to the beyond the cheek over the medical website. For the very first two days, apply ice as a lot as feasible. This considerably reduces post-operative swelling, which subsequently decreases any discomfort. Do not use warmth to the medical location for the first 2 days. After two days, cozy compresses might be applied on the cheek. Face or neck bruising after surgery might happen in some people. If this occurs, it is not a negative indicator of recovery nor will it impact the result of the treatment. 4 ORAL HEALTH. Normal oral health in every location of the mouth, except for at the medical website, ought to be returned to the night of surgical treatment. Brushing, flossing, watering devices, interproximal brushes, as well as other dental hygiene method ought to be discontinued at the surgical site for the initial week complying with surgical treatment. You will be given an anti-plaque mouthwash that will help tidy and decontaminate the medical site without brushing as well as flossing at the website. This mouthwash needs to be utilized by delicately washing two times daily (as well as say goodbye to) for 30 secs. Usage for one week (unless or else guided). Prevent usage of any kind of industrial mouthwashes. At your post-operative appointment, you will be advised on when as well as the best ways to return to oral health at the surgical site. 5. DIET REGIMEN For the first week after surgery, as soft diet plan is necessary to prevent any kind of disruptions to the medical site. Completely stay clear of anything hard, crunchy or small that might obtain or interrupt captured in the medical site (seeds, nuts, popcorn, chips). If this takes place, an infection of the surgical site may occur. To guarantee proper recovery of the medical site, it is vital that you obtain ample nutrients, minerals and vitamins, also when on a soft diet plan Chew any kind of soft foods on the side opposite the surgical treatment for the first week. If both sides of the mouth had surgical treatment executed, a full fluid diet regimen is advised for the first week. Lots of fluids should be consumed in order to achieve ideal healing. Avoid any kind of carbonated beverages the initial week adhering to surgical treatment. 6. SUTURES. Stitches are in place in order to help keep the gum tissue in position throughout the preliminary healing duration. Avoid allowing your tongue to really feel or disturb stitches. This often causes sutures to befall too soon. Do not select, pull or cut stitches on your own. If a lose suture is irritating to you, please call our office, as well as we will certainly see you promptly for a stitch trim. Most or every one of your stitches will certainly be removed at your post-operative consultation. 7. IMPLANT As Well As IMPLANTING SITES. It is extremely important to prevent any type of trauma (eating) in this field for the initial week after surgical procedure. The location must be shielded preferably for the very first 4 weeks adhering to surgical treatment in order to accomplish the ideal results (no crispy or tough foods on that side of the mouth). 8. EXERCISE Prevent any type of laborious activity or hefty lifting for the initial 2-3 days after surgery. 9. SMOKING CIGARETTES. Cigarette smoking dramatically affects proper healing following gum surgical treatment. All cigarette smoking needs to be quit up until suture elimination. Following implant surgical procedure, smoking cigarettes cessation is suggested eight weeks adhering to surgical treatment. Cigarette smoking adversely impacts implant success prices, but smoking cessation 8 weeks complying with surgical treatment has been shown to lower failure prices. 10. ALCOHOL Alcohol must not be consumed during the preliminary recovery procedure. Depending on the antibiotic or pain medicine being taken post-operatively, the usage of alcohol is often banned.
